Talk to the insurance agent or company rep. They will gladly give you a quote and take your money. You may want to consider just taking liability insurance on a car around 10 years old, as the cost for collision coverage will be more than they would pay for a total loss. Also, some states mandate a 10% discount if you take an approved defensive driving course.
